I have had excellent results cleaning the outside of shells by putting
the shell in a solution of 75% bleach. Purex, something like that. It
does not damage the shell. It DOES disolve the periostricum and the
hinges on bivalves. It loosens encrustations fairly quickly. Try 15
minutes. I have also (unintentionally) left shells in such a solution
overnight with no bad results. You must wash them off in fresh water.
And you may be sure your hands will smell like bleach for the rest of
the day.
